Description  Protocols: SW837 cells were grown in DMEM/F-12 medium supplemented with 10% fetal bovine serum, 100 units/ml penicillin and 100 μg/ml streptomycin at 37°C and 5% CO2. Upon washing with PBS, cells were crosslinked with 1% formaldehyde for 20 minutes and quenched using 125 mM glycine. Upon scraping, nuclear pellets were prepared in and washed with the nuclear preparation buffer (150mM NaCl, 20 mM EDTA, 50 mM Tris-HCl (pH 7.5), 0.5% v/v NP-40, 1% v/v Triton-X-100, 20 mM NaF). Samples were sonicated in sonication buffer (150mM NaCl, 20 mM EDTA, 50 mM Tris-HCl (pH 8), 1% v/v NP-40, 0.5% v/v Sodium deoxycholate, 20 mM NaF, 0.1% SDS) for 20 cycles (30s on/off). Samples were precleared using 50% Sepharose 4B slurry (GE Healthcare) and incubated with the respective antibodies overnight: H3K27ac (196-050, Diagenode), H3K79me3 (C15310068, Diagenode) and H2Bub1 (55465, Cell Signaling). Sepharose beads with Protein A (for rabbit antibodies) or Protein G (for mouse antibodies) were added to samples and incubated for 2 hours followed by washes, de-crosslinking, and DNA extraction. DNA extraction was performed using Roti(R)-phenol/chloroform/Isoamylalcohol (Roth) followed by precipitation in 100% ethanol and washes with 70% ethanol. Libraries for DNA from ChIP were made using the NEBNext Ultra DNA library preparation kit according to the manufacturer's instructions.
